Accordingly, we propose a consensus mechanism combining DPoS and PBFT, which can rapidly deal … WebMar 9, 2024 · We model the blockchain as a queueing system as shown in Figure 2.User transactions arrive at the transaction pool queue according to a Poisson process with arrival rate and wait there until the miner (server) completes its current mining round. The miner then picks up transactions from the pool and starts generating the next block. rods that find water
